The System 3 speaker systems, from Harold Beveridge, are probably the most visually pleasing speakers ever offered. Furthermore, they are among the best sounding speakers available at any price.

A member of the ADI staff bought a pair for his own system, and has visited several other System 3 owners to combine their user information with his own. The results are impressive. As the data shows, published performance is very close to the performance measured in the listening room.

With the exception of the impedance (not a problem with sufficiently stable amplifiers), the Beveridge System 3 measured better than any other speaker we've seen. These cylinders can produce a more uniform and coherent wavefront than anything else we've measured, and are less depended upon room acoustics than a more conventional speaker.

Modifications

We found the wood cylinder to be insufficiently damped. The addition of mass, in the form of automobile undercoating mastic applied to the interior surface of the cylinder, substantially improves sound below 500 Hz. About 20# per pair is recommended.

Cables

The speaker works best with low DCR wiring; 10 gauge stranded is recommended. The optimum cable for the System 3 is probably Mogami, and the slight added capacitance should pose no additional problems for any amplifier stable enough to handle these speakers under any conditions.
